Overview

This is a combination therapy consisting of three components: 1. **Dipyridamole**: A nucleoside transport inhibitor that can potentially enhance the cytotoxicity of fluorouracil in a dose-dependent manner. 2. **Fluorouracil (5-FU)**: A chemotherapy drug that destroys quickly dividing cells, such as cancer cells. It works by interfering with DNA synthesis and RNA function. 3. **Folinic acid (Leucovorin)**: Not a chemotherapy drug itself, but a biochemical modulator that enhances the efficacy of fluorouracil by stabilizing the binding of fluorouracil to its target enzyme, thymidylate synthase. The rationale behind this combination is that dipyridamole may increase the intracellular concentration of fluorouracil by inhibiting nucleoside transport, while folinic acid enhances fluorouracil's cytotoxic effects by providing an expanded folate pool. This combination has been studied in Phase I and Phase II clinical trials for various advanced malignancies, particularly colorectal cancer.
